Transaction c28a324c29cdbc8d88241e53e22233cb2caa7c0cd85b4c94dea145239cbb5cc3

6 Input
2 Outputs
  • c28a324c29cdbc8d88241e53e22233cb2caa7c0cd85b4c94dea145239cbb5cc3:0
  • value  18777920
    address  3NDuDT5hgenHpBXg3arxiAE546PpYBLGae
  • c28a324c29cdbc8d88241e53e22233cb2caa7c0cd85b4c94dea145239cbb5cc3:1
  • value  964260
    address  1JdLnYRKwERQe2ioXJRRcD46xQYHK3GjWY